Transaction 24e8c8e6c95ba053639b9c46082c06baf43a9237fd31959f0ad6cc85e82fe290
1 Input
1 Output
-
24e8c8e6c95ba053639b9c46082c06baf43a9237fd31959f0ad6cc85e82fe290:0
- value
- 1357920737
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85962af6cd4fe02b8a1c188951d645c3bcb03a8e OP_EQUAL
- address
- 3DsMguCfFvhNsMaFh68w2aN8hPdnb7E7Dy